In today's highly competitive business landscape, customer satisfaction plays a crucial role in determining the success of a company. Understanding the needs and preferences of customers is essential for providing exceptional products and services. To gain insights into the level of customer satisfaction in New Zealand, a recent survey was conducted, uncovering key findings and trends. In this blog post, we will explore the survey results and their implications for businesses operating in New Zealand. The survey was conducted across various industries, including retail, hospitality, telecommunications, and e-commerce. A diverse range of customers were polled, representing different age groups, genders, and locations. The findings highlight the overall sentiment of New Zealand customers and shed light on areas that require improvement. Overall, the survey results revealed a positive customer satisfaction rating, with approximately 75% of respondents expressing satisfaction with their recent customer experiences. This indicates that the majority of businesses in New Zealand are meeting customer expectations and delivering quality products and services. When examining the factors that contribute to customer satisfaction, several key themes emerged. The top factors identified by respondents include friendly and knowledgeable staff, quick response times, and high-quality products or services. These elements consistently ranked high across all industries, emphasizing the importance of delivering exceptional customer service and maintaining product quality standards. Interestingly, the survey also uncovered areas where businesses can further enhance customer satisfaction. Prompt and effective problem resolution emerged as a crucial factor in driving customer happiness. Customers value companies that can swiftly address their issues and provide satisfactory solutions. This underscores the significance of investing in robust customer support systems and training staff to handle customer concerns efficiently. In terms of communication channels, the survey revealed a shift towards digital platforms. The majority of respondents preferred online channels such as email, live chat, and social media for interacting with businesses. Consequently, companies need to prioritize their online presence and ensure that customer inquiries and complaints are promptly and adequately addressed across these platforms. Furthermore, the survey highlighted the growing importance of personalization in customer satisfaction. Customers appreciate tailored experiences and personalized recommendations based on their preferences and previous interactions. Businesses that can leverage customer data and advanced analytics to offer personalized experiences are likely to excel in customer satisfaction. The survey findings also indicate that customer loyalty is closely tied to satisfaction levels. The majority of satisfied customers expressed willingness to recommend the businesses they were satisfied with to their friends and family. Creating loyalty programs, offering exclusive deals, and soliciting customer feedback are effective strategies to foster customer loyalty. In conclusion, the survey results reflect a positive customer satisfaction rating in New Zealand, indicating that businesses are generally meeting customer expectations. However, there are still areas that require improvement, such as prompt problem resolution, personalized experiences, and effective communication across digital platforms. By focusing on these aspects, businesses can enhance customer satisfaction and cultivate long-term customer loyalty. Understanding customer needs and preferences will continue to be vital for businesses aiming to thrive in the New Zealand market.
